Understanding anxiety disorders
Anxiety disorders can have a devastating effect in those who suffer from them. Left anxiety untreated disorders often inhibit the ability of the individual to function normally in everyday life. Anxiety disorder can also be a source of further tension caused by the strain the condition placed on personal and professional relationships. There are various categories of anxiety disorders, such as post-traumatic stress disorder, panic disorder, social anxiety disorder and obsessive-compulsive disorder, but more commonly diagnosed is generalized anxiety disorder. Anxiety disorders can be difficult to diagnose as the symptoms associated with them often are shared by a variety of diseases such as depression and chronic fatigue. In the past, the medical misdiagnose often anxiety disorder associating the symptoms with other diseases while neglecting their cause. This often led to treatments that were ineffective or only served to inhibit the repetitions of specific symptoms.
